Transaction 311b5bc588212f2c8d650f0dbf7b16c4e584318a9257e57719bcadda8981af23

1 Input
2 Outputs
  • 311b5bc588212f2c8d650f0dbf7b16c4e584318a9257e57719bcadda8981af23:0
  • value  2616398
    address  1K3EvP7FpN7QvewrEy7vBru9xmLhz7KUms
  • 311b5bc588212f2c8d650f0dbf7b16c4e584318a9257e57719bcadda8981af23:1
  • value  18381817
    address  3Mg7CaBWtvNgELoVAkSwKkrCzbQzNSwP3b